Define the Executor (Worker Thread)
The responsibility of the Executor (or Worker Threads) is to execute instructions on behalf of a client-server connection. The Executor must designed to process requests sent from client Workstations. The Worker Thread is accountable for executing instructions (or performing work) for the client application. It is also responsible for sending and receiving data back and forth to the client station. Actually, the Worker Thread will make requests into the SCM for these data-transmission requests.
